The driver retrieves the panel from the output port via DT, but doesn't retrieve the DSI host from the input port?
Wouldn't this driver need to call a "mipi_dsi_attach" at some point to link with the DSI host (and pass parameters like number of lanes, color format etc)?
I've been working on a patchset[1] which lets i2c drivers create mipi dsi devices. I think this would be needed for the ps8640 driver too.
